Fierce self-compassion How women can harness kindness to speak up, claim their power, and thrive

Kristin Neff

Book - 2021

Drawing on research, her personal life story and empirically supported practices, the author of Self-Compassion shows women how to reclaim balance within themselves and use fierce and tender self-compassion to ensure their own wholeness and well-being.
